Job Title – Corporate Finance Manager
Job Location – London
Our client is recruiting a Manager in their Lead Advisory team within Corporate Finance. This role will give you the opportunity to develop your experience in mergers and acquisitions, management buy-outs, fundraising, re-financing, financial modelling, strategic review and other associated areas predominantly in the UK mid-market.
In the role you will manage a wide range of transactions (including sale mandates, fundraising, MBOs, financial modelling and other advisory work) from origination to completion, acting as a key point of contact for the team and driving the business plan while exploring opportunities to build the pipeline.
This role also gives the opportunity to actively contribute to business development and deal origination initiatives.
Key responsibilities
- You will support the Partners/Directors in all aspects of advisory work.
- Contribute to developing the team’s internal processes and framework to deliver a high standard of services to our clients.
- Establish and grow a network of key contacts and participate in the team’s marketing initiatives.
You will report directly to the Partners/Directors who will expect you to:
- Project manage a transaction process throughout and ensure the day-to-day requirements of a deal process are fulfilled.
- Identify key issues impacting transactions at an early stage and be able to plan for numerous outcomes and present solutions to the client.
- Have a strong understanding of typical mid-market deal structures involving financial buyers or trade buyers and the common issues arising therein.
- Have a strong understanding of the legal documentation associated with typical mid-market M&A transactions and be comfortable reviewing the same.
- Possess exceptional interpersonal skills required for regular client and contact liaison throughout deal processes, managing legal advisors and specialist advisors throughout a deal process.
- Undertake detailed research on companies and associated sectors, analysing trends, opportunities, potential transactions and potential investors/buyers.
- Possess strong writing skills in order to prepare Information Memoranda, business plans and similar funding packs/documentation and have a track record of preparing the same.
- Be well versed in Excel with strong financial modelling expertise.
- Able to model integrated operating financial models, funding models (including the appropriate equity/debt funding overlays) and financial models suitable for the appraisal of investment opportunities or buyouts.
- Take responsibility for project risk issues and billing/cost recovery.
- Lead assignment teams on deals, developing junior staff.
- Actively participate in practice development activities and deal origination initiatives.
- Participate and take an active role in completion meetings/presentations with clients and funders.
- You will also be required to regularly participate in networking events.
Each member of the Team is required to attend relevant Corporate Finance training held both externally and internally.
